Four arrested for supermarket robbery

Four persons were held by police in connection with a supermarket robbery in Chase Village. The men stole $1,400.00 and a quantity of cigarettes. The following is a press release from the TTPS:

Four persons ranging in ages 17 to 20 years, will appear virtually before a Chaguanas Magistrate today, Monday 23rd August after being held for a robbery at Summer’s Supermarket, Chase Village on Wednesday 18th August 2021. SAMUEL ROOPCHAND, 20, of Calcutta No.4 Freeport, and TERRELL ST CYR, 18, of Primrose Drive, Chase Village along with two minors both aged 17, were held on Thursday 19th August in connection with the robbery.

Around 2:15 pm on Wednesday the four men, three of whom were armed with cutlasses, entered the supermarket and announced a robbery. They stole $1,400.00 and a quantity of cigarettes. They then escaped on foot in an unknown direction. The men were charged by P.C. RAMPERSAD of the Freeport police station.
